Celtic battling newly promoted Premier League side for 17 year old talent

Celtic are reportedly battling with newly promoted Ipswich Town for the signature of a Queen’s Park talent. Aidan McGinley is attracting interest despite having never played a first team game for the Spiders.

According to Record Sport, Celtic are keen on the 17-year-old starlet as they look to sign a player that could develop into a future first team talent.

Ipswich are said to have offered the Scotland U17 a trial and appear to be front runners for the signature but the Scottish Champions could offer an alternative with Norwich City also vying for his signature.
